Transaction 33c17810e7008a124c957d32619ebd79705b6c0c896eb83dd9c5e242e4c8bb4c

1 Input
2 Outputs
  • 33c17810e7008a124c957d32619ebd79705b6c0c896eb83dd9c5e242e4c8bb4c:0
  • value  2290133
    address  3LCh2Z6c4S6mM9MUcJJV22zApaYeNFKmZ5
  • 33c17810e7008a124c957d32619ebd79705b6c0c896eb83dd9c5e242e4c8bb4c:1
  • value  190000
    address  3PuGH13pwPKArwX6ougkZkPi9FiaS2f1Tx